| Your Excel version | Recovery possibility | |-------------------|----------------------| | .xls (old, weak encryption) | High – removal or fast brute-force | | .xlsx (no password for opening, only sheet protection) | High – removal with free scripts | | .xlsx (password to open, strong AES) | Low – only slow brute-force or paid service | | .xlsx with Agile encryption (Office 365) | Extremely low – virtually uncrackable with strong password |
